I've had a lovely start to the year today. Tuesdays are normally my day at home so this week is pretty much a normal working week for me ( after having worked the last three days ) but it's nice to have a day off work when everyone else is off. For the last 17 years I've worked weekends, so it's only on Bank holidays that I really get to experience what weekends must be like for Mon-Fri 9-5 workers.

This morning I had a walk on the moor with Mr M and Eban up to White Wells to watch the tradition of locals taking the punge in the Victorian plunge pool. I've taken the plunge a couple of times over the years, but decided just to have a hot chocolate from the cafe this year and watch other people freeze instead. Ilkley is a fairly small place and loads of people I now were up there, it's great living somewhere that has a proper community feel about it.

After taking a few photos ( mainly of all the windswept dogs that had been taken up to white wells ) Myself and Mr M wandered back in to town. I bumped in to one of my Neighbours Patrick and invited him along for a pub lunch. Patrick went for the vegetarian all day breakfast option ( and to balance things out a little ) I went for the huge mixed grill option. Very nice it was as well.

Once I'd had my fill of food and washed it down with my second hot chocolate of the day I called around to visit the P's to catch up with all they've done over Christmas and new year.
